EUR/USD is trading at 1.0773, up 0.0016.
The pair is trading rangebound and a little higher on the day after Monday's sharp move up.
Eurostat reported that Euro area third quarter gross domestic product (GDP) was 1.7 percent versus 1.6 percent in the second quarter. Quarter over quarter Euro area GDP rose 0.3 percent versus 0.3 rise in the second quarter.
The Euro area November retail PMI (purchasing managers survey) was unchanged at 48.6 versus 48.6 in October.
